A good antique late 18th century Welsh oak dresser, with plate rack and pot board below, circa 1790.
This is a very attractive and honest piece of vernacular Welsh antique furniture, from the South Wales region, the dresser is all original including the finish, pulls and hardware and of desirable size.
One of the main features of a South wales dresser compared to a North Wales dresser is that the plate racks were always open and the plates stand in a grove and rest against the wall when the dresser is in place. The other feature is that the dresser bases would have pot-boards rather than cupboards and large pans and pots would be stored on them.
This dresser displays those typical South Wales attributes, the plate rack having a series of 30 iron and brass hand-forged hooks to the front of the shelves allowing items with handles to be hung up.
The dresser base with five drawers with the original bun shaped pulls and each drawer is inlaid with a diamond shape bone escutcheon, the front of the dresser with four elegantly turned legs, pot-board to the base and raised on turned feet.
